The Big Questions: What is a War?

What is a war? Why does it happen? Who does it affect-and why do we remember?

This premium, full-colour picture book helps children aged 5-12 understand war with truth and care. It doesn't glorify conflict, and it doesn't pretend it isn't real. Instead, it explains what war is, what it costs, and how peace is built-through clear storytelling and powerful, cinematic artwork.

Inside, children will explore what war is and why it can change everything; why wars begin (fear, power, resources, beliefs, and misunderstanding); who is involved (soldiers, leaders, civilians, helpers, and peacemakers); what happens during war and the effects that can last for years; how people avoid war, rebuild trust, and protect peace; and why we remember-Remembrance, poppies, and the promise to learn from history.

Written by Ethan Solace, an interdisciplinary psychologist specialising in child development, this book is designed to be age-appropriate and non-graphic, while still meaningful for older children and classroom discussion. Perfect for families, teachers, and libraries.
